Method and device for encryption and decryption
    3.
    发明申请
    Method and device for encryption and decryption 审中-公开
    用于加密和解密的方法和设备

    公开(公告)号:US20060259769A1

    公开(公告)日:2006-11-16

    申请号:US11397028

    申请日:2006-03-30

    IPC分类号: H04L9/00

    CPC分类号: H04L9/065 H04L2209/125

    摘要: Applying both an encryption and also a decryption algorithm, which is inverse to the encryption algorithm, as an encryption definition to thereby enable the use of an encryption unit and a decryption unit of an encryption/decryption device simultaneously, i.e. temporally overlapping, in an encryption process when a part of the data to be encrypted is supplied to the encryption unit while the other part is supplied to the decryption unit. The result is encrypted data or is a cipher text, respectively, whose parts are only “encrypted” in a different way. During decryption, it only has to be guaranteed by suitable regulations that those parts which were encrypted by the encrypted unit are again decrypted by the decryption unit, while the other parts which were “encrypted” by the decryption unit are “decrypted” by the encryption unit.

    摘要翻译: 将与加密算法相反的加密和解密算法应用为加密定义,从而能够在加密中同时使用加密/解密装置的加密单元和解密单元,即时间上重叠 当将一部分要被加密的数据提供给加密单元,而另一部分被提供给解密单元时,处理。 结果是分别是加密数据或密文,其部分仅以不同的方式“加密”。 在解密过程中,必须通过适当的规定来保证被加密单元加密的部分再次被解密单元解密,而由解密单元“加密”的其他部分由加密“解密” 单元。

    Method and device for encryption/decryption
    4.
    发明申请
    Method and device for encryption/decryption 审中-公开
    用于加密/解密的方法和设备

    公开(公告)号:US20060265604A1

    公开(公告)日:2006-11-23

    申请号:US11396189

    申请日:2006-03-30

    IPC分类号: G06F12/14

    CPC分类号: H04L9/0618

    摘要: An encryption unit and decryption unit located in an encryption/decryption device may be used both for encryption and decryption, without their effects canceling each other out when, between the decryption input of the decrypter and the encryption output of the encrypter. An encryption combiner maps the encryption result data block at the encryption output to a mapped encryption result data block according to an encryption combining mapping and is exemplarily used when encrypting. A decryption combiner maps the encryption result data block at the encryption output to an inversely mapped encryption result data block according to a decryption combining mapping which is inverse to the encryption combining mapping and is exemplarily used when decrypting.

    摘要翻译: 位于加密/解密装置中的加密单元和解密单元既可以用于加密和解密,也可以在加密解密器的解密输入与加密器的加密输出之间进行解密,而不会影响加密/解密装置的效果。 加密组合器根据加密组合映射将加密输出处的加密结果数据块映射到映射的加密结果数据块,并且在加密时被示例性地使用。 解密组合器根据与加密组合映射相反的解密组合映射将加密输出处的加密结果数据块映射到反映射的加密结果数据块,并且在解密时被示例性地使用。

    Word-individual key generation
    5.
    发明申请
    Word-individual key generation 有权
    单词密钥生成

    公开(公告)号:US20060265563A1

    公开(公告)日:2006-11-23

    申请号:US11396211

    申请日:2006-03-30

    IPC分类号: G06F12/00

    CPC分类号: G06F12/1408

    摘要: Apparatus and method for generating an individual key for accessing a predetermined addressable unit of a memory divided into addressable units. The apparatus includes a calculator for calculating a page pre-key based on a page address, a determiner for determining the individual key based on the page pre-key and a unit address, a memory for storing the calculated page pre-key, and a checker for checking whether during a next access to a further predetermined unit to which a further unique address is associated, an already calculated page pre-key exists in a temporary memory, which has been calculated based on a page address of a unique address, which is identical to the page address of the further unique address, and, if so, transmitting the already calculated page pre-key to the determiner by bypassing the calculator, and, if not, transmitting the page address of the further unique address to the calculator.

    摘要翻译: 用于生成用于访问分为可寻址单元的存储器的预定可寻址单元的单独密钥的装置和方法。 该装置包括:用于基于页面地址计算页面预设键的计算器,用于基于页面预设键确定个人密钥的确定器和单元地址,用于存储所计算的页面预设键的存储器和 检查器,用于检查在下一次访问与另一唯一地址相关联的另外的预定单元期间是否存在已经计算的页面预密钥,该临时存储器已经基于唯一地址的寻址地址来计算, 与另一唯一地址的页面地址相同,如果是,则通过绕过计算器将已经计算的页面预密钥发送到确定器,如果不是,则将另外的唯一地址的页面地址发送到计算器 。

    Word-individual key generation
    6.
    发明授权
    Word-individual key generation 有权
    单词密钥生成

    公开(公告)号:US07451288B2

    公开(公告)日:2008-11-11

    申请号:US11396211

    申请日:2006-03-30

    IPC分类号: G06F12/00 G06F12/14

    CPC分类号: G06F12/1408

    摘要: Apparatus and method for generating an individual key for accessing a predetermined addressable unit of a memory divided into addressable units. The apparatus includes a calculator for calculating a page pre-key based on a page address, a determiner for determining the individual key based on the page pre-key and a unit address, a memory for storing the calculated page pre-key, and a checker for checking whether during a next access to a further predetermined unit to which a further unique address is associated, an already calculated page pre-key exists in a temporary memory, which has been calculated based on a page address of a unique address, which is identical to the page address of the further unique address, and, if so, transmitting the already calculated page pre-key to the determiner by bypassing the calculator, and, if not, transmitting the page address of the further unique address to the calculator.

    摘要翻译: 用于产生用于访问分为可寻址单元的存储器的预定可寻址单元的单独密钥的装置和方法。 该装置包括:用于基于页面地址计算页面预设键的计算器,用于基于页面预设键确定个人密钥的确定器和单元地址,用于存储所计算的页面预设键的存储器和 检查器,用于检查在下一次访问与另一唯一地址相关联的另外的预定单元期间是否存在已经计算的页面预密钥,该临时存储器已经基于唯一地址的寻址地址来计算, 与另一唯一地址的页面地址相同,如果是,则通过绕过计算器将已经计算的页面预密钥发送到确定器,如果不是,则将另外的唯一地址的页面地址发送到计算器 。

    Device and method for generating a pseudorandom sequence of numbers
    7.
    发明授权
    Device and method for generating a pseudorandom sequence of numbers 有权
    用于产生数字的伪随机序列的装置和方法

    公开(公告)号:US07502814B2

    公开(公告)日:2009-03-10

    申请号:US11120659

    申请日:2005-05-02

    IPC分类号: G06F1/02

    CPC分类号: G06F7/584

    摘要: A device for generating a pseudorandom sequence of numbers includes a feedforward coupler, which has a plurality of memory units, and a feedback coupler connected between an input and an output of the feedforward coupler. The feedback coupler includes a changeable feedback characteristic and is embodied to change the feedback characteristic depending on a state of a memory unit of the plurality of memory units of the feedforward coupler.

    摘要翻译: 用于产生伪随机序列序列的装置包括具有多个存储器单元的前馈耦合器和连接在前馈耦合器的输入和输出端之间的反馈耦合器。 反馈耦合器包括可变的反馈特性,并且被实现为根据前馈耦合器的多个存储器单元的存储器单元的状态来改变反馈特性。

    Device and Method for Error Correction and Protection Against Data Corruption
    9.
    发明申请
    Device and Method for Error Correction and Protection Against Data Corruption 有权
    用于纠错和防止数据损坏的设备和方法

    公开(公告)号:US20120198302A1

    公开(公告)日:2012-08-02

    申请号:US13016308

    申请日:2011-01-28

    IPC分类号: H03M13/29 G06F11/10

    摘要: A device for protecting a data word against data corruption includes first and second determiners. The first determiner is configured to determine an error correction code cvA associated with a data word a so that cvA=aAT, with A being a generator matrix of a linear systematic base correction code, the columns of which enable performance of an x-bit error correction on replica of the data word a and the associated error correction code cvA. The second determiner is configured to determine an extended error correction code cvE so that (cvA|cvE)=aFT, with F being an extended generator matrix F = ( A E ) of an extended linear systematic correction code, the columns of which enable, using the extension error correction code cvE, performance of an y-bit error correction, with y>x, on a replica of the data word a and the associated error correction code cvA.

    摘要翻译: 用于保护数据字免受数据损坏的设备包括第一和第二确定器。 第一确定器被配置为确定与数据字a相关联的纠错码cvA,使得cvA = aAT,其中A是线性系统基本校正码的生成矩阵,其列允许执行x位错误 对数据字a和相关纠错码cvA的副本进行校正。 第二确定器被配置为确定扩展误差校正码cvE,使得(cvA | cvE)= aFT,其中F是扩展的线性系统校正码的扩展生成矩阵F =(AE),其列允许使用 扩展误差校正码cvE,在数据字a和相关联的纠错码cvA的副本上执行具有y> x的y位纠错的性能。

    Apparatus and method for protecting the integrity of data
    10.
    发明申请
    Apparatus and method for protecting the integrity of data 有权
    用于保护数据完整性的装置和方法

    公开(公告)号:US20070033417A1

    公开(公告)日:2007-02-08

    申请号:US11425103

    申请日:2006-06-19

    IPC分类号: G06F12/14

    摘要: By arranging a redundancy means and a control means upstream from an encryption means which encrypts and decrypts the data to be stored in an external memory, the integrity of data may be ensured when the generation of redundancy information is realized by the redundancy means, and when the generation of a syndrome bit vector indicating any alteration of the data is implemented by the control means. What is preferred is a control matrix constructed from idempotent, thinly populated, circulant square sub-matrices only. By arranging redundancy and control means upstream from the encryption/decryption means, what is achieved is that both errors in the encrypted data and errors of the non-encrypted data may be proven, provided that they have occurred in the data path between the redundancy/control means and the encryption/decryption means.

    摘要翻译: 通过在从存储在外部存储器中的数据进行加密和解密的加密装置的上游配置冗余装置和控制装置,当通过冗余装置实现冗余信息的生成时,可以确保数据的完整性, 通过控制装置实现表示数据的任何改变的校正子位向量的生成。 优选的是由幂等的,稀疏的,循环的方形子矩阵构成的控制矩阵。 通过从加密/解密装置上游布置冗余和控制装置,实现了加密数据中的两个错误和非加密数据的错误可以被证实,只要它们已经在冗余/ 控制装置和加密/解密装置。